STORAGE AND DISTRIBUTION - DESCRIPTION AND OPERATION
____________________________________________________
General (Fig. 1 and 2)
_______
A. The water storage and distribution system supplies drinkable water to the galley unit and to the washbasin in the lavatory compartment. The system includes the equipment that is necessary to store and deliver water to the above units. The supply of water is monitored by quantity indicators as described in 38-14-60, Water Quantity Indicating. To ensure an adequate flow of water to each dispensing component, the system is pressurized as described in 38-15-60, Water Tank Pressurization. The system consists of water storage tanks, distribution tubing, and the following valves: one fill/drain valve, one overflow/depressurization valve, self-venting faucets in the lavatory, and a water shutoff valve in each lavatory and galley compartment.
B. The water lines that connect the water tanks to the lavatory and galley are of two types, rigid tubes of corrosion resistant steel, and nylon braid reinforced teflon hoses. The supply and the drain lines are installed with a positive slope to allow complete drainage. Water lines that pass through cold areas are protected by in-line heaters and insulation blankets.
Water Tanks
___________
A. The potable water is stored in two fiberglass tanks located on the right side of the forward cargo compartment.
B. Each tank has a volumetric capacity of 11 US gallons. The usable capacity in each tank is limited to 10 US gallons by a fill limiting tube.
C. Each tank has an immersion heater to keep the water above 0°C.

A. A faucet assembly is installed in each lavatory compartment. It provides hot, cold or warm water at the washbasin through a common spout. The faucet assembly has two cartridges with valves that control the flow of water. A cartridge is located in the body of each hot and cold water faucet, under the control handle.
(1)
Hot or cold water flow is controlled by depressing the hot or cold handle which in turn actuates a plunger valve in the cartridge.
(2)
The water flow will stop when the control handles are released.
(3)
Self-venting capability is provided by the bleed valve fitted under the spout. The valves close when the water system is pressurized and open to vent the hot and cold water faucets when system pressure is below 0.5 psig.
